9:04 More than 100 babies died in Florida last year as a result of unsafe sleep practices, and the Department of Children and Families is asking the public to purchase what are known as sleep sacks to help low-income families put their babies to sleep in a safe manner.

8:30 Despite the bad rap that older drivers get, a new study shows senior citizens are the first to say that many of their peers shouldn't be on the road. The survey was conducted by the research arm of Triple-A. It shows that most seniors support strict driver license renewal rules for people their own age.
